Thermostat installation services involve replacing or upgrading your existing thermostat to improve the control and efficiency of your heating and cooling systems. This process typically includes removing the old thermostat, preparing the wiring and mounting area, and installing a new device that offers better functionality or modern features. Professional service providers can ensure the thermostat is correctly wired and calibrated, helping to optimize your home’s temperature regulation and energy use. Proper installation is essential for the thermostat to operate reliably and accurately, providing comfort and convenience throughout the year.

These services are especially helpful when homeowners experience issues with their current thermostat, such as inconsistent temperature control, frequent system cycling, or unresponsiveness. Upgrading to a newer model can also address problems caused by outdated technology, such as limited programmability or compatibility issues with smart home systems. A properly installed thermostat can help reduce energy waste, lower utility bills, and improve overall comfort by maintaining a more consistent indoor climate. Service providers can recommend suitable thermostat options based on the specific heating and cooling equipment in a property.

The overview below groups typical Thermostat Installation proj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in Fremont, CA.

In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.

Smaller Repairs - Minor thermostat repairs or adjustments typically cost between $100 and $250, depending on the issue and parts needed. Many routine fixes fall within this range, making it an affordable option for simple problems.

Standard Installation - Replacing an existing thermostat with a new, basic model usually ranges from $250 to $600. Local contractors often handle these installations efficiently, with most projects landing in this middle range.

Full System Replacement - Upgrading an entire HVAC system and installing a new thermostat can cost between $2,000 and $5,000 or more for larger, more complex projects. These tend to be less common but are necessary for extensive upgrades.

High-End or Smart Thermostats - Installing advanced, smart thermostats with features like remote control and learning capabilities generally costs $300 to $800. Many projects in this category fall into this range, though premium models can push higher depending on the system complexity.

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.
